How the New Application Process Works: A Step-by-Step Guide for Students

The new application process for residence permits in Germany aims to streamline the experience for international students. First, prospective students must gather their essential documents, including proof of admission to a recognized institution and financial resources. Once prepared, they can submit their application online through a dedicated portal, which allows for real-time tracking of their application status.

Next, applicants will receive a confirmation email with instructions for booking an appointment at their local immigration office. During the appointment, students will present their documents and undergo a brief interview to clarify their intentions and study plans. Following this, the processing time is expected to be significantly reduced, with many students receiving their permits within a few weeks, facilitating a smoother transition to their academic journey in Germany.
